Output 3dc72383726e40ec1cdc1f564b43de41b4ea31db38f58f9c8094a837d6af05de:5

value
1595284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a34ebbb4d086dcc879f7619870be6f77faeaa5 OP_EQUAL
address
362uKNGB8St4SZNLJ8XeNCyFqZxqBEtbdz
transaction
3dc72383726e40ec1cdc1f564b43de41b4ea31db38f58f9c8094a837d6af05de
spent
true